Will QRNG Disrupt the Connected Devices Market?
The ability to generate random numbers is essential to encrypting data. However, any classical method of producing randomness will fundamentally be deterministic - and theoretically predictable. This creates an opportunity for non-deterministic, high entropy quantum random number generators (QRNGs). The Emerging Industrial Thermal Energy Storage Market
With ~90% of industrial heating processes using fossil fuels, this has led to approximately 25% of global energy pollution coming from heat produced for industrial processes. As such, demand for technologies to decarbonize industrial heating is expected to increase. One such technology that is able to store and supply heat to industrial processes is thermal energy storage (TES). TES for industrial applications currently only forms a minor percentage of global TES capacity, given that TES systems have been widely deployed in applications such as pairing with concentrated solar power (CSP) plants, district heating, cold chain, and space heating for buildings.

Metal vs Graphite Bipolar Plates: A Key PEM Fuel Cells Debate
Bipolar plates are crucial components in proton exchange fuel cells, representing a substantial portion of the value of the fuel cell stack. IDTechEx predicts that their market value will surpass US$2.5 billion by 2034. The choice between metal and graphite materials for bipolar plates is a significant consideration, with each option having distinct advantages depending on the specific application.
